Turquoise Mountain is a non-profit, non-governmental organization specializing in urban regeneration, business development, and education in traditional arts and architecture. We seek to provide education, skills and livelihoods to Afghan men and women. Since 2006 Turquoise Mountain has cleared 36,000 cubic meters of rubbish from the streets, restored or built 170 historic and community buildings, created a primary school and a clinic, and installed water, electricity, and sanitation through the historic traditional craft neighborhood of Murad Khani in the old city of Kabul. It has created the internationally accredited Institute for Afghan Arts & Architecture, training the next generation of craftsmen and women in woodwork, jewelry and gem cutting, calligraphy and miniature painting, and ceramics. Finally, it has sold over US$15,000,000 of Afghan artisan products internationally.
Job Summary
This is a core position in the Turquoise Mountain Afghanistan country office that will drive forward its programmatic strategy. The successful candidate will oversee the office’s areas of programming – Artisan Development, Built Heritage, Health, and Education – across its geographic locations of Kabul, Balkh, Jawzjan, and Bamiyan. The Head of Programs will work closely with the Country Director, in-country team, and key central team members to ensure technical excellence, program quality, and effective management of the office’s programming. A core focus of the role will be to drive forward the organisation’s commercial vision, particularly in the carpet sector.
Reporting directly to the Turquoise Mountain Afghanistan Country Director, the postholder will play an essential role in instilling the organisation’s workplace culture and values. The Head of Programs will supervise a diverse team of sector professionals and facilitate meaningful ways to strengthen program integration and cross-sector collaboration. The successful candidate will cultivate strong working relationships with all heads of department and function leads to foster positive and unified program and commercial operations within the country office.
The Head of Programs will support the Country Director in strategy development, program design, and fundraising initiatives, and contribute to external engagements with a range of stakeholders, including the authorities, donors, and partners.
The successful candidate will be a resourceful, proactive, collaborative, and solutions-oriented leader who can build strong working relationships with a variety of stakeholders, both internal and external. The position will be based in Kabul, Afghanistan, with travel to Turquoise Mountain Afghanistan’s field sites.
